DMB / DFE

Developer: DMB

General Contractor: Southwest Architectural Builders (SAB)

Architect: Krause – Architecture + Interiors

Location: 6263 N. Scottsdale Rd., Suite 330, Scottsdale

Size: 10,000 SF

Brokerage Firm: Lee & Associates

Value: $1.8 million

Start/Completion: 11/2019-4/2020

Subcontractors: LIR metalsMirror worksTodekInterior WorksAdobe PaintReeves PaperhangingAccent Marble & GraniteNorconClimatecATSSierra FireIOC Systems

Project Description: This corporate office, just under 10,000 SF, combines a major developer and their partner foundation. As two separate companies under one roof, the challenge was creating one seamless space that still allowed privacy, with a high-end, transitional aesthetic. The solution became a bifurcated floor plan with shared central communal spaces, and a finish palette influenced by designers like Ralph Lauren. A large investment at $140/SF, virtual reality via 3D modeling ensured clarity and aided in approval of the final design. Undulating lights in the reception area contrast with the rigidity of wood and stone surfaces.

Playa del Norte

Developer: Irgens

General Contractor: A.R. Mays

Architect: WORKSBUREAU

Location: 999 E. Playa del Norte Dr., Tempe

Size: 94,311 SF

Brokerage firm: Lee & Associates

Value: $40 million

Start/Completion: Q1/2020-Q2/2021

Subcontractors: ABCO Electric; Spectrum Mechanical; Baker Concrete

Project Description: Offering prominent freeway signage along the south side of the Loop 202 Freeway, Playa del Norte is Tempe’s newest technology-centric, high-profile, Class A office building. The project is ideally positioned at the gateway to downtown Tempe and ASU’s main campus with a full-diamond freeway interchange at Scottsdale Road. This six-story structured parking project is just over 94,000 SF with 27,000 SF floor plates. Playa del Norte will have best-in-class filtration systems, touch-free access, and hardscape conducive to the demands of today’s office talent.
